Well, we have our first show that has broken the trend of series having their episode order cut instead of being outright cancelled.
ABC has pulled its freshman series Wicked City from its schedule after just three episodes. In it’s place, the network will air reruns of Shark Tank.
The series is currently filming Episode 8 and production will end after its completion.
In recent months, networks have been more than patient with series on their schedules and for shows like Fox’s Minority Report and NBC’s The Player, they opted to cut the episode order instead of cancellation.
The heavily promoted Wicked City premiered to low ratings and continued to drop the next two episodes. The most recent episode saw a 0.4 Live+Same Day rating among adults 18-49-not good.
It would seem that the 10pm Tuesday night slot on ABC’s schedule is the kiss of death. Lucky 7, Killer Women and Mind Games have all been cancelled after just a few episodes. Only Forever and Body of Proof were able to air at least one full season.
